保存了带宏的excel文档,保存为.xlsm格式,重新打开,无法运行宏

重新打开后,提示“发现不可读取的内容,是否恢复此工作薄的内容”。我点击“是”,紧接着出现一个框,提示“通过修复或删除不可读取的内容,excel已经能打开该文件”,框内还有信息“已删除的部件: 部件 /xl/vbaProject.bin。 (Visual Basic for Applications (VBA))”
点击“关闭”,关闭这个提示框,带宏的excel打开。可是无法运行宏。出现一个提示框“可能是因为该宏在此工作薄中不可用,或者所有的宏都被禁用”。
注意:1.我用的excel2010,盗版的
2.“宏的安全性”那里,我已经设置为“启用所有宏”了。

请问怎么回事。图片是刚打开时出现的提示框。

第1个回答  2012-06-30
你的office2007没有激活,建议你激活之后再试。追问

麻烦你教我怎样激活,谢谢

追答

我到网络上下载一个office2007注册机

第2个回答  2012-07-03
重新设一个宏
我是专业的,我来教你
第3个回答  2012-06-30
Tapio: 如果是这样,你进入VBE环境下看一下,你写的VBA程序还在不在? 有可能不在那儿,需要你重新放进去,我遇到过有点类似。本回答被提问者采纳